1.25 Billion chicken wing portions to be consumed Super Bowl weekend: NCC

January 24, 2012

Source: Americans to Consume 1.25 Billion Chicken Wings Super Bowl Weekend

The upcoming Super Bowl matchup between the New York Giants and the New England Patriots should hold chicken wing consumption steady with last year’s level, but only because Giants fans will out-eat their Patriot fan nemeses.

New Englanders and Patriots fans are 6 percent less likely than the national average to order chicken wings at a food service establishment, while fans of the New York Giants and those others in the Mid-Atlantic region are 24 percent more likely, according to the National Chicken Council, citing NPD Group data.

NCC predicted 100 million pounds of wings (1.25 billion wing portions) would be consumed during Super Bowl weekend, with about half ordered from restaurants and half purchased from retail stores. The game is played Feb. 5.

During 2012, the NCC estimates more than 3 billion pounds of wings (25 billion wing portions) will be sold.

Prices

Wholesale prices for chicken wings have jumped to record highs ahead of Super Bowl XLVI, bolstered by industry production cutbacks, USDA data show.

Wholesale wing prices in the Midwest ranged from $1.75 to $1.96 per pound for the week of Jan. 16 to Jan. 20. That’s up from an average price of $1.47 for the month of December, and more than double the price paid six months ago, according to USDA data

‘Beyond the Border’ fails to address ON and PQ speed limiters

December 13, 2011

While the new border agreement is extensive, one issue not addressed are our speed limiters. US truckers find it too difficult to comply with regulations North of the border, and Canadian trucks see unnecessarily higher costs when traveling at 65mph on US highways posted at 70-75mph.
